I Grew Up Among Criminals – Singer Omah Lay

Singer Stanley Omah Didia, popularly known as Omah Lay, has said he grew up among criminals in Port Harcourt, Rivers State.

The singer said this in an interview on Hey! Steph channel, shared on Tuesday.

He said that growing up in that environment shaped him into who he had become and that he wouldn’t want anyone else to grow up in that environment.

He said, “I grew up among criminals. It’s crazy. I grew up in Marine Base. If you know that place very much, you will know that it’s like one place in Port Harcourt where people didn’t use to go at the time I was growing up.

“I grew up around criminals, thugs and stuff like that. I grew up around pipelines, illegal business and stuff like that. So, there were a lot of troubles for me but what I said is part of the things that made me what I’m today and I am really grateful for.”
